Transaction e28639d90f8098037c2b4213b76e0ebe4c87b06f1f2ce26df1a6bb4dc22d1093
1 Input
1 Output
-
e28639d90f8098037c2b4213b76e0ebe4c87b06f1f2ce26df1a6bb4dc22d1093:0
- value
- 2901786
- script pubkey
- OP_0 OP_PUSHBYTES_20 50993282230ae27e2e7a8f6a9afd1c84696d1efd
- address
- bc1q2zvn9q3rpt38utn63a4f4lgus35k68ha8kvkks